<hr/><a name="_details"></a><h2>Detailed Description</h2>
<h3>template &lt;class T_return, class T_arg1 = nil, class T_arg2 = nil, class T_arg3 = nil, class T_arg4 = nil, class T_arg5 = nil, class T_arg6 = nil, class T_arg7 = nil&gt;<br/>
 class sigc::signal&lt; T_return, T_arg1, T_arg2, T_arg3, T_arg4, T_arg5, T_arg6, T_arg7 &gt;</h3>

<p>Convenience wrapper for the numbered <a class="el" href="classsigc_1_1signal.html" title="Convenience wrapper for the numbered sigc::signal# templates.">sigc::signal</a># templates. </p>
<p>signal can be used to <a class="el" href="classsigc_1_1signal7.html#adc55ac9b0f935fd87a67904022e03cb2" title="Add a slot to the list of slots.">connect()</a> slots that are invoked during subsequent calls to <a class="el"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it()</a>. Any functor or slot can be passed into <a class="el" href="classsigc_1_1signal7.html#adc55ac9b0f935fd87a67904022e03cb2" title="Add a slot to the list of slots.">connect()</a>. It is converted into a slot implicitly.</p>
<p>If you want to connect one signal to another, use <a class="el" href="classsigc_1_1signal7.html#a0948c25035b18b01efa60d08b26f6d51" title="Creates a functor that calls emit() on this signal.">make_slot()</a> to retrieve a functor that emits the signal when invoked.</p>
<p>Be careful if you directly pass one signal into the <a class="el" href="classsigc_1_1signal7.html#adc55ac9b0f935fd87a67904022e03cb2" title="Add a slot to the list of slots.">connect()</a> method of another: a shallow copy of the signal is made and the signal's slots are not disconnected until both the signal and its clone are destroyed, which is probably not what you want!</p>
<p>An STL-style list interface for the signal's list of slots can be retrieved with <a class="el" href="classsigc_1_1signal7.html#a68153d9079b4881352113079cd6216f7" title="Creates an STL-style interface for the signal&#39;s list of slots.">slots()</a>. This interface supports iteration, insertion and removal of slots.</p>
<p>The template arguments determine the function signature of the <a class="el"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it()</a> function:</p>
<ul>
<li><em>T_return</em> The desired return type of the <a class="el"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it()</a> function.</li>
<li><em>T_arg1</em> Argument type used in the definition of <a class="el"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it()</a>. The default <code>nil</code> means no argument.</li>
<li><em>T_arg2</em> Argument type used in the definition of <a class="el"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it()</a>. The default <code>nil</code> means no argument.</li>
<li><em>T_arg3</em> Argument type used in the definition of <a class="el"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it()</a>. The default <code>nil</code> means no argument.</li>
<li><em>T_arg4</em> Argument type used in the definition of <a class="el"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it()</a>. The default <code>nil</code> means no argument.</li>
<li><em>T_arg5</em> Argument type used in the definition of <a class="el"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it()</a>. The default <code>nil</code> means no argument.</li>
<li><em>T_arg6</em> Argument type used in the definition of <a class="el"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it()</a>. The default <code>nil</code> means no argument.</li>
<li><em>T_arg7</em> Argument type used in the definition of <a class="el"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it()</a>. The default <code>nil</code> means no argument.</li>
</ul>
<p>To specify an accumulator type the nested class <a class="el" href="classsigc_1_1signal_1_1accumulated.html" title="Convenience wrapper for the numbered sigc::signal# templates.">signal::accumulated</a> can be used.</p>
<dl class="user"><dt><b>Example:</b></dt><dd><div class="fragment"><pre class="fragment"> <span class="keywordtype">void</span> foo(<span class="keywordtype">int</span>) {}
 <a class="code" href="classsigc_1_1signal.html" title="Convenience wrapper for the numbered sigc::signal# templates.">sigc::signal&lt;void, long&gt;</a> sig;
 sig.<a class="code" href="classsigc_1_1signal7.html#adc55ac9b0f935fd87a67904022e03cb2" title="Add a slot to the list of slots.">connect</a>(<a class="code" href="group__ptr__fun.html#gada8b678665c14dc85eb32d25b7299465" title="Creates a functor of type sigc::pointer_functor0 which wraps an existing non-member function...">sigc::ptr_fun</a>(&amp;foo));
 sig.<a class="code" href="classsigc_1_1signal7.html#a5ee8eaa67f05f84ee185841142a34fb0" title="Triggers the emission of the signal.">emit</a>(19);
</pre></div> </dd></dl>
